     58 int trace = 0;
     59 FILE *fd = 0;
     60 int	margc;
     61 int	fromatty;
     62 #define MAX_MARGV	20
     63 char	*margv[MAX_MARGV];
     64 char	cmdline[200];
     65 jmp_buf	toplevel;
     66 static const struct cmd *getcmd(char *);
     67 static int drop_privileges(void);
     68 
     69 int
     70 main(int argc, char *argv[])
     71 {
     72 	const struct cmd *c;
     73 
     74 	fcntl(3, F_CLOSEM);
     75 	openlog("timedc", 0, LOG_AUTH);
     76 
     77 	/*
     78 	 * security dictates!
     79 	 */
     80 	if (priv_resources() < 0)
     81 		errx(EXIT_FAILURE, "Could not get privileged resources");
     82 	if (drop_privileges() < 0)
     83 		errx(EXIT_FAILURE, "Could not drop privileges");
     84 
     85 	if (--argc > 0) {
     86 		c = getcmd(*++argv);
     87 		if (c == (struct cmd *)-1) {
     88 			printf("?Ambiguous command\n");
     89 			ex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
     90 		}
     91 		if (c == 0) {
     92 			printf("?Invalid command\n");
     93 			ex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
     94 		}
     95 		(*c->c_handler)(argc, argv);
     96 		exit(EXIT_SUCCESS);
     97 	}
     98 
     99 	fromatty = isatty(fileno(stdin));
    100 	if (setjmp(toplevel))
    101 		putchar('\n');
    102 	(void) signal(SIGINT, intr);
    103 	for (;;) {
    104 		if (fromatty) {
    105 			printf("timedc> ");
    106 			(void) fflush(stdout);
    107 		}
    108 		if (fgets(cmdline, sizeof(cmdline), stdin) == NULL)
    109 			quit(0, NULL);
    110 		if (cmdline[0] == 0)
    111 			break;
    112 		if (makeargv()) {
    113 			printf("?Too many arguments\n");
    114 			continue;
    115 		}
    116 		if (margv[0] == 0)
    117 			continue;
    118 		c = getcmd(margv[0]);
    119 		if (c == (struct cmd *)-1) {
    120 			printf("?Ambiguous command\n");
    121 			continue;
    122 		}
    123 		if (c == 0) {
    124 			printf("?Invalid command\n");
    125 			continue;
    126 		}
    127 		(*c->c_handler)(margc, margv);
    128 	}
    129 	return 0;
    130 }

    142 static const struct cmd *
    143 getcmd(char *name)
    144 {
    145 	const char *p;
    146 	char *q;
    147 	const struct cmd *c, *found;
    148 	int nmatches, longest;
    149 	extern const struct cmd cmdtab[];
    150 	extern int NCMDS;
    151 
    152 	longest = 0;
    153 	nmatches = 0;
    154 	found = 0;
    155 	for (c = cmdtab; c < &cmdtab[NCMDS]; c++) {
    156 		p = c->c_name;
    157 		for (q = name; *q == *p++; q++)
    158 			if (*q == 0)		/* exact match? */
    159 				return(c);
    160 		if (!*q) {			/* the name was a prefix */
    161 			if (q - name > longest) {
    162 				longest = q - name;
    163 				nmatches = 1;
    164 				found = c;
    165 			} else if (q - name == longest)
    166 				nmatches++;
    167 		}
    168 	}
    169 	if (nmatches > 1)
    170 		return((struct cmd *)-1);
    171 	return(found);
    172 }
    173 
    174 /*
    175  * Slice a string up into argc/argv.
    176  */
    177 int
    178 makeargv(void)
    179 {
    180 	char *cp;
    181 	char **argp = margv;
    182 
    183 	margc = 0;
    184 	for (cp = cmdline; argp < &margv[MAX_MARGV - 1] && *cp;) {
    185 		while (isspace((unsigned char)*cp))
    186 			cp++;
    187 		if (*cp == '\0')
    188 			break;
    189 		*argp++ = cp;
    190 		margc += 1;
    191 		while (*cp != '\0' && !isspace((unsigned char)*cp))
    192 			cp++;
    193 		if (*cp == '\0')
    194 			break;
    195 		*cp++ = '\0';
    196 	}
    197 	if (margc == MAX_MARGV - 1)
    198 		return 1;
    199 	*argp++ = 0;
    200 	return 0;
    201 }

    262 static int
    263 drop_privileges(void)
    264 {
    265 	static const char user[] = "_timedc";
    266 	const struct passwd *pw;
    267 	uid_t uid;
    268 	gid_t gid;
    269 
    270 	if ((pw = getpwnam(user)) == NULL) {
    271 		warnx("getpwnam(\"%s\") failed", user);
    272 		return -1;
    273 	}
    274 	uid = pw->pw_uid;
    275 	gid = pw->pw_gid;
    276 	if (setgroups(1, &gid)) {
    277 		warn("setgroups");
    278 		return -1;
    279 	}
    280 	if (setgid(gid)) {
    281 		warn("setgid");
    282 		return -1;
    283 	}
    284 	if (setuid(uid)) {
    285 		warn("setuid");
    286 		return -1;
    287 	}
    288 	return 0;
    289 }
